Key Insights
The United States backup power systems market, a significant segment of the global market, is experiencing robust growth, driven by increasing concerns over power outages and the rising adoption of renewable energy sources. The market, valued at approximately $XXX million in 2025 (a logical estimation based on the global market size and regional distribution, assuming a significant US market share), is projected to exhibit a Compound Annual Growth Rate (CAGR) mirroring the global average of 5.10% through 2033. This growth is fueled by several key factors. Firstly, the increasing frequency and severity of natural disasters, such as hurricanes and wildfires, are driving demand for reliable backup power solutions, particularly in residential and commercial sectors. Secondly, the integration of renewable energy sources, like solar and wind power, often necessitates backup systems to ensure continuous power supply during periods of low generation. Finally, the growing reliance on critical infrastructure and technology, across industries from healthcare to data centers, mandates robust backup power systems to prevent significant financial losses and disruptions. The market is segmented by technology (backup generators, UPS systems, and other technologies like fuel cells), and end-user (residential, commercial, and industrial), reflecting diverse application needs and technological advancements. The competitive landscape includes major players like Generac Holdings Inc., Kohler Co., and Eaton Corporation PLC, each vying for market share through innovation, strategic partnerships, and geographic expansion.

Notable Milestones in United States Backup Power Systems Market Sector
- June 2022: Microsoft partnered with Eaton to integrate backup power systems into the electricity grid.
- December 2022: Caterpillar demonstrated a hydrogen fuel cell backup power system for Microsoft data centers.
- March 2023: Honda introduced a new stationary fuel cell power system using repurposed fuel cells from its Clarity vehicle.

8. Can you provide examples of recent developments in the market?
March 2023: Honda introduced a new stationary fuel cell power system to power its data center at the American Honda headquarters in Torrance, California. The stationary power system uses repurposed fuel cells from Honda's Clarity fuel cell electric vehicles. Individual fuel cells are combined into 250-kW stacks, with two of these stacks placed at Honda's factory.
